Organization: US Institute of Peace
Country: Iraq
Closing date: 12 Aug 2017

THE ORGANIZATION The United States Institute of Peace (USIP) prevents, mitigates and resolves violent conflicts around the world by engaging directly in conflict zones and providing analysis, education and resources to those working for peace.

SUMMARY

The Program Officer, Iraq (PO), under the supervision of the Regional Program Manager for the Middle East (RPM), exercises management, planning, financial oversight and public outreach for USIP's Iraq program, with a specific focus on projects related to minorities and reconciliation. The PO will report to the RPM and and work in close coordination with USIP's field based team in Erbil and Baghdad, support staff in USIP's Tunis Regional Hub, and team members in Washington DC. The position also requires close coordination with USIP's strategic national partner, Sanad for Peacebuilding. The PO will be responsible for ensuring that projects are being implemented accordingly to the work plan, and that reporting and financial requirement are being implemented accordingly. This position will be based in either Baghdad or Erbil, with final duty station determined by USIP and the successful candidate at a later time.

MAJOR D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Working with the RPM, identifies program opportunities in Iraq, based on thorough needs assessment and in line with USIP mandate and strategy.

  • Leads implementation of USIP's program activities in Iraq in line with established goals, objectives, and partnership agreements. This includes the projects Supporting Problem-Solving Dialogues for Iraq's Religious Minorities and Governance Issues,â€? and “Advancing the Role of Minorities in Stabilization and Governance.â€?

  • Ensures all program activities are implemented within program timelines and in a manner that meets program standards and objectives.

  • Manages existing program budget to ensure that program is operating within budget limitations and meeting goals and objectives.

  • Acts as a main focal point for USIP’s partners in country.

  • Identifies and maintains critical stakeholder relationship as they relate to program focus.

  • Oversees and delivers monthly, quarterly, and annual reporting for both internal and external project stakeholders, including responsibility for the development, editing and timely submission of any donor progress reports that may be required, including coordinating with HQ and/or regional counterparts who are providing key inputs.

  • Ensures the highest level of communication and cooperation with relevant USIP departments/divisions/teams and external partners.

  • Supports efforts to represent the program in internal and external events and to disseminate information about USIP’s programs and research findings.

  • Provides project briefings to governmental or other organizations on key subject matter areas.

  • Travel to USIP HQ and Tunis Regional Office to meet with key USG stakeholders and participate in strategic planning sessions with regional and thematic teams, and to Erbil, Sulianiya and Baghdad as required.

  • Keep up-to-date on new research and programs as they relate to USIP’s program focuses.

  • Research and write on USIP’s program focuses.

  • Performs other duties as assigned.

QUALIFICATIONS

  • Master's degree in political science, international affairs, law, or related field required; equivalent work experience may be substituted for Master's degree.

  • A minimum of three (3) years of program coordination and direct- implementation experience in the field is required, preferably in a post-conflict setting.

  • Demonstrated experience in project design, implementation, and monitoring and evaluation.

  • Strong interest and experience with innovative programming and problem solving skills.

  • Good research, analytical and writing skills. Able to write effectively in a variety of formats and for a variety of audiences.

  • Experience working in Iraq.

  • Good level of understanding of the current conflict dynamics in Iraq and the region at large.

  • Demonstrated experience coordinating with officials in government, international organizations, and national partners.

  • Fluency in English and good working knowledge of Arabic required; fluency in Arabic is preferred.
